Product-oriented assessments evaluate the final product or outcome of a task, such as a research paper or project presentation. Examples include grading a student's artwork, evaluating the quality of a written report, or assessing the functionality of a software prototype. These assessments focus on the end result rather than the process used to achieve it.
There are basically five areas that are believed to affect an individual employee's motivation and job performance: skill variety, task identity, task significance, autonomy, and feedback.

There are a number of objectives for performing task analysis -- one of which is: To identify all facets of a task (assumptions, starting point, ending point, knowledge/ability necessary, steps, completion criteria, etc.) that can be used to build a training program for replacement workers and/or continuous training to ensure performance is maintained at a minimum level.

"Your heart's not in it" is a saying that means that while you may be going through the motions of a task, the performance of the task could have been better if you had more enthusiasm. It usually means poor performance due to a bad attitude.
